Ever since I was very young I have been VERY matchy matchy. Like, if my Strawberry Shortcake shirt had Pink and green and white in it, I would insist on stacking pink and green and white socks with white and pink LA Gears (Obviously, I am a child of the 80s). I had this black and white patterned suspender romper that I wore with an off the shoulder cropped black shirt (you know the kind with the elasticized neckline and puffed sleeves) that had lace on the bottom like bloomers, that I paired with white lacy socks and shiny black patent leather lace-up shoes with sheer ribbon laces. Anyway you get the point. As an adult, I realize that there are whole families of colors that when worn together, are considered monochromatic - not necessarily matchy matchy. When you take these color families and break them up among one outfit into contrasting textures, this combination is even more interesting and less matchy. As I integrate colored leggings into my wardrobe, I have the strongest inclination to make them match completely with the rest of the outfit. I TRY to let them be a contrasting / coordinating element, but these Gray ones BEGGED to be paired with pale neutrals.
